Paycom is an HR and payroll platform built on a single database, covering talent acquisition, time management, payroll, benefits administration, and talent management, with all workforce data held in one system rather than synced between modules.
Firms encounter it as an existing client system at mid-sized businesses. The reporting is the main point of contact — payroll registers, tax filings, and benefits costs feeding financial statements, tax preparation, and audit support, with general ledger export posting journals by department or cost centre.
The employee-verification approach changes the firm’s workload more than it might seem. When employees confirm their own pay before submission, errors are caught before the run rather than corrected afterwards, and off-cycle corrections are what generate reconciliation problems, amended filings, and awkward conversations at year end.
The single-database architecture means a change to an employee record propagates across payroll, benefits, time, and HR at once, eliminating the sync failures that occur between separate systems.
Payroll handles multi-state employment, garnishments, and complex earnings structures with tax filing managed by the provider. Time and attendance, scheduling, recruiting, onboarding, performance, and learning management are all part of the same platform.
Employee self-service is delivered through a mobile app covering pay, benefits, time off, and personal details.
Mid-sized US businesses, roughly 50 to several thousand employees, that want a single system of record for the workforce and are prepared to commit to one vendor across HR and payroll.
Smaller businesses find the scope and cost well beyond their needs and are better served by Gusto, OnPay, or Patriot Payroll. Paylocity and ADP Workforce Now are the direct competitors and worth quoting alongside it.
